Nigeria Army flags-Off Operation Last Hold In Borno
The Nigerian Army has officially flagged off Operation LAST HOLD in Monguno, Borno State to mark the commencement of the operation.
Chief of Army Staff (COAS), Lieutenant General Tukur Yusufu Buratai who was represented by the Chief of Training and Operations (Army) Major General David Ahmadu also commissioned the office complex of the Headquarters Operation LAST HOLD at the Kinasara Barracks Monguno.
Major General Ahmadu proceeded to Gudunbali in the company of the Theatre Commander Operation Lafiya Dole Major General Rogers Nicholas, where they physically conducted the symbolic traditional house sweeping and farm clearing as part of the Civil-Military aspect of Operation LAST HOLD and to practically demonstrate the humanitarian posture of the operation.
Speaking during the event, Major General Ahmadu stated that, the farm clearing symbolises the readiness to commence the farming season and enjoined the returning Internally Displaced Persons (IDPs) to resume their farming occupation as they settle down in their communities.
The Theatre Commander, however, described the move of the IDPs as the first step towards returning them to their communities.
He appealed to all Humanitarian Agencies in the North East to support the program to assist the Internally Displaced Persons, restore their occupations and pick up their lives again.
He also assured all of the adequate security of the lives and properties for the returnee as they settle down.
